在Angular中使用動畫來增強用戶體驗可以通過Angular的內(nèi)置動畫模塊 @angular/animations 來實現(xiàn)。下面是一個簡單的示例,演示如何在Angular中使用動畫來為頁面過渡和元素
在Angular中,可觀察對象的取消和清理是非常重要的,以避免內(nèi)存泄漏和資源浪費。當訂閱一個可觀察對象時,需要在適當?shù)臅r候取消訂閱并清理資源。以下是一些常見的取消和清理機制: 使用Subscrip
要在Angular中創(chuàng)建自定義的路由解析器以在路由激活之前獲取數(shù)據(jù),可以按照以下步驟進行操作: 創(chuàng)建一個新的服務(wù)來處理路由解析邏輯。在該服務(wù)中,你需要實現(xiàn)一個resolve方法來返回一個Observ
預(yù)渲染是在構(gòu)建過程中生成靜態(tài)HTML文件的過程,這些文件可以直接在瀏覽器中加載,而不需要等到Angular應(yīng)用程序在客戶端運行時才生成。預(yù)渲染的好處包括: 更快的加載速度:預(yù)渲染的靜態(tài)HTML文件
在Angular中處理觸摸事件和手勢識別可以通過使用HammerJS庫來實現(xiàn)。HammerJS是一個用于處理觸摸事件和手勢識別的JavaScript庫。 以下是在Angular中使用HammerJS處
Angular的Service Workers可以幫助我們緩存靜態(tài)資源,以提高網(wǎng)站的加載性能。以下是使用Angular的Service Workers來緩存靜態(tài)資源的步驟: 在Angular項目中安
Angular是一個開發(fā)平臺,用于構(gòu)建Web應(yīng)用程序。PWA(Progressive Web Apps)是一種新型的Web應(yīng)用程序,結(jié)合了傳統(tǒng)Web應(yīng)用程序和原生移動應(yīng)用程序的優(yōu)點。PWA可以在各種設(shè)
在Angular中使用Web Workers來執(zhí)行后臺任務(wù)以提高主線程的性能可以通過以下步驟實現(xiàn): 創(chuàng)建一個新的Web Worker文件:首先創(chuàng)建一個新的JavaScript文件,作為Web Wo
在Angular中實現(xiàn)表單的自動保存和恢復(fù)功能可以通過以下步驟實現(xiàn): 創(chuàng)建一個表單組件并在其中定義一個表單。在表單中添加需要保存和恢復(fù)的輸入字段。 使用Angular的Reactive For
在Angular中,視圖查詢是一種在模板中查找特定元素或指令的方法。視圖查詢可以通過@ViewChild和@ContentChild裝飾器來實現(xiàn)。 @ViewChild裝飾器用于在組件的模板內(nèi)查詢子組